Synopsis Dear Dragon by : Josh Funk

A sweet and clever friendship story in rhyme, about looking past physical differences to appreciate the person (or dragon) underneath. George and Blaise are pen pals, and they write letters to each other about everything: their pets, birthdays, favorite sports, and science fair projects. There’s just one thing that the two friends don’t know: George is a human, while Blaise is a dragon! What will happen when these pen pals finally meet face-to-face? Synopsis Arthur's Pen Pal by : Lillian Hoban

Arthur thinks his pen pal is more fun than his little sister. Little sisters don't do things like karate and wrestling -- or do they? It takes a surprise letter to show Arthur that sometimes there's more to sisters -- and pen pals -- than meets the eye!

Synopsis The Pen Pal by : Storm Young

The Pen Pal follows the story of Shiloh Ray, who is a military wife, new mother, and college student. Shiloh also suffers from postpartum depression and overall loneliness from living in rural Alaska far away from any family or friends. Shiloh then breaks out of her comfort zone and signs up for a Pen Pal. Weeks pass and she is matched with Penelope Young, this is where her whole life will change. Shiloh and Penelope become the best of friends and write letters every week. Until one day the letters just stop. Penelope had vanished. Shiloh cannot handle the thought of losing her best friend, so she flies across the country to figure out what she did wrong, or what happened to Penelope. Once she gets there, she finds out from Penelope's husband that she is missing. Shiloh takes matters into her own hands, finding out the truth of what happened to her friend. Shiloh will follow clues and figure out the truth no matter what the cost. She also meets a few unexpected friends along the way to help her. Shiloh and her friends will face many challenges and have to race against the clock to find out the truth before someone else covers it up. Trigger Warning! There is talk of suicidal thoughts and mental illness

Synopsis Karen's Pen Pal (Baby-Sitters Little Sister #25) by : Ann M. Martin

From the bestselling author of the generation-defining series The Baby-sitters Club comes a series for a new generation! Dear Maxie...The kids in Ms. Colman’s class are writing letters to some second-graders in New York City. Karen thinks having a pen pal is so, so cool. But then her pen pal turn out to be a big bragger. Mazie says she is better than Karen at everything. This makes Karen so mad. So she starts making things up. But now Mazie’s class is coming to visit. And Karen is in gigundo trouble!

Synopsis Polly's Pen Pal by : Stuart J. Murphy

Polly's got a pen pal ... in Canada! Polly's sure that she and her new friend, Ally, will have a lot in common. When Ally writes that she's 125 centimeters tall and weighs 25 kilograms, Polly wants to know if she's the same. Polly wishes she could go and visit her -- but Ally lives 450 kilometers away! Young readers will learn about metric units like centimeters, kilograms, kilometers, and liters as they follow this story of two friends who can't be kept apart.

Synopsis My Grandma, My Pen Pal by : Jan Dale Koutsky

"My Grandma, My Pen Pal" won the Teacher's Choice Award from the International Reading Association in 2003. This story is about a grandmother and grandchild who develop a special bond through letters and visits. "My Grandma, My Pen Pal" is appropriate for first and second grade curriculum, and for grandparents.
